Chirudih Population - Puruliya, West Bengal
Chirudih is a medium size village located in Barabazar Block of Puruliya district, West Bengal with total 157 families residing. The Chirudih village has population of 953 of which 501 are males while 452 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Chirudih village population of children with age 0-6 is 144 which makes up 15.11 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chirudih village is 902 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Chirudih as per census is 1028, higher than West Bengal average of 956.
Chirudih village has lower liter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Chirudih village was 67.49 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Chirudih Male literacy stands at 82.09 % while female literacy rate was 50.92 %.

Chirudih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 157 | - | - |
Population | 953 | 501 | 452 |
Child (0-6) | 144 | 71 | 73 |
Schedule Caste | 88 | 48 | 40 |
Schedule Tribe | 8 | 4 | 4 |
Literacy | 67.49 % | 82.09 % | 50.92 % |
Total Workers | 534 | 283 | 251 |
Main Worker | 222 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 312 | 99 | 213 |
